Fresno City College sits in Fresno, CA.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 9 culinary arts degrees were awarded at Fresno City College.

Online & Distance Learning at Fresno City College

Distance learning is available at Fresno City College. Of 28,071 students, 8,294 (30%) studied exclusively online and 7,452 (27%) took at least some classes online.
